Recently, LONGi Green Energy's second-generation BC technology Hi-MO 9 product (LR8-66HYD) proudly received the photovoltaic 'Pacesetter' Advanced Technology Product Certification from the Third-Party Agency China General Certification (CGC). This certification not only represents a high level of recognition for LONGi’s product performance but also signifies that BC technology has ascended to the next level of innovation.

The LONGi second-generation bifacial modules, boasting an industry-leading conversion efficiency of up to 24.8% and a maximum power output of 670W (conventional size of 2382x1134mm), are at the forefront of the industry. The cell efficiency has reached 26.52%, earning the 'Frontier Technology Class A' rating. BC technology employs an unobstructed 'full light capture' approach, working like a lens to focus sunlight and convert every ray into electrical energy—achieving 'zero waste' in ultimate efficiency. Under equal lighting conditions, it transforms even more solar energy into electrical energy, resulting in surplus power generation benefits for the users.

The receipt of an A+ grade in the comprehensive maturity level assessment from CGC is a powerful acknowledgment of the technological prowess of Hi-MO 9. During the testing process, the product underwent rigorous and standardized assessment, excelling in performance and reliability, and reaching the pinnacle of industry standards. About LONGi

Founded in 2000, LONGi is committed to being the world’s leading solar technology company, focusing on customer-driven value creation for full scenario energy transformation.

Under its mission of 'making the best of solar energy to build a green world', LONGi has dedicated itself to technology innovation and established five business sectors, covering mono silicon wafers cells and modulescommercial & industrial distributed solar solutionsgreen energy solutions and hydrogen equipment. The company has honed its capabilities to provide green energy and has more recently, also embraced green hydrogen products and solutions to support global zero carbon development. www.longi.com
